Staff Frontend Engineer (Platform)
PhantomFull Time
Mid-level (3 to 4 years), Senior (5 to 8 years)
Candidates must have at least 8 years of development experience, with Ruby, Rails, and React being beneficial but not mandatory. Strong leadership skills, including mentoring experience, and effective communication, both written and verbal, are essential. Experience building user experiences within complex products and a commitment to writing clean, tested, and organized code are required. Familiarity with agile environments and the ability to think through problems from first principles and a customer perspective are also valued.
The Staff Platform Engineer will develop critical consumer flows for new and existing features, collaborating with product and design teams to scope and plan work. This role involves creating flexible execution plans and mentoring other engineers to enhance their skills and potential.
Technology solutions for cannabis dispensaries
Dutchie provides technology solutions tailored for the cannabis industry, focusing on both medicinal and recreational dispensaries. Their product offerings include Point of Sale (POS) systems, e-commerce platforms, payment solutions, and insurance services, all designed to help dispensaries manage operations, comply with regulations, and enhance customer experiences. The POS systems, previously known as LeafLogix and Greenbits, facilitate smooth transactions while ensuring adherence to local laws. The e-commerce platform allows customers to conveniently order cannabis products for delivery or pickup. Dutchie's business model is based on software as a service (SaaS), charging dispensaries a subscription fee and earning revenue through transaction fees. The company's goal is to make cannabis safe and accessible for everyone, emphasizing compliance and legality in all operations, while also supporting social change initiatives like the Last Prisoner Project.